An electron enters a region of magnetic field of magnitude0.016 T, traveling perpendicular to thelinear boundary of the region. The direction of the field isperpendicular to the velocity of the electron.(a) Determine the time it takes for theelectron to leave the "field-filled" region, noting that its pathis a semicircle. ________________ns
(b) Find the kinetic energy of the electron if the radius of itssemicircular path is 2.20 cm.
